Subversion
|
Time/date utilities. More...
Go to the source code of this file.
Functions | |
const char * | svn_time_to_cstring (apr_time_t when, apr_pool_t *pool) |
Convert when to a const char * representation allocated in pool. More... | |
svn_error_t * | svn_time_from_cstring (apr_time_t *when, const char *data, apr_pool_t *pool) |
Convert data to an apr_time_t when. More... | |
const char * | svn_time_to_human_cstring (apr_time_t when, apr_pool_t *pool) |
Convert when to a const char * representation allocated in pool, suitable for human display in UTF8. | |
svn_error_t * | svn_parse_date (svn_boolean_t *matched, apr_time_t *result, const char *text, apr_time_t now, apr_pool_t *pool) |
Convert a human-readable date text into an apr_time_t , using now as the current time and storing the result in result. More... | |
void | svn_sleep_for_timestamps (void) |
Sleep until the next second, to ensure that any files modified after we exit have a different timestamp than the one we recorded. More... | |
Time/date utilities.
Definition in file svn_time.h.
svn_error_t* svn_parse_date | ( | svn_boolean_t * | matched, |
apr_time_t * | result, | ||
const char * | text, | ||
apr_time_t | now, | ||
apr_pool_t * | pool | ||
) |
Convert a human-readable date text into an apr_time_t
, using now as the current time and storing the result in result.
The local time zone will be used to compute the appropriate GMT offset if text contains a local time specification. Set matched to indicate whether or not text was parsed successfully. Perform any allocation in pool. Return an error iff an internal error (rather than a simple parse error) occurs.
void svn_sleep_for_timestamps | ( | void | ) |
Sleep until the next second, to ensure that any files modified after we exit have a different timestamp than the one we recorded.
svn_error_t* svn_time_from_cstring | ( | apr_time_t * | when, |
const char * | data, | ||
apr_pool_t * | pool | ||
) |
Convert data to an apr_time_t
when.
Use pool for temporary memory allocation.
const char* svn_time_to_cstring | ( | apr_time_t | when, |
apr_pool_t * | pool | ||
) |
Convert when to a const char *
representation allocated in pool.
Use svn_time_from_cstring() for the reverse conversion.